Why Hurdsfield-Tuffy Lake has no grade

We grade a lake only when the monitoring record supports a letter: at least three phosphorus or chlorophyll-a samples in the last ten years, scored against EPA National Lakes Assessment thresholds for this lake’s ecoregion. For Hurdsfield-Tuffy Lake, no nutrient or algae measurement meets the evidence bar (at least 3 samples within 10 years). Sampling here has recorded water clarity and algae (chlorophyll-a), but not phosphorus.

Not Rated is not an F. It is EPA Integrated Reporting Category 3 — insufficient information. The water here may be excellent or poor; nobody has measured enough of it to say. Everything below that has been measured is still reported on this page.

Sampling is run by NDDEQ and volunteer programs, and published through the EPA Water Quality Portal. Read the full grading methodology.

Fishing Hurdsfield-Tuffy Lake

Reservoir Info (USACE NID)

Hurdsfield-Tuffy Lake is a man-made reservoir impounded by the Thompson Dam; Norman 1 (completed 1968), built primarily for recreation on the James River-TR; earth-type dam, 22 ft tall and 368 ft long.
